Common Stonework Repair Jobs
Stonework Restoration - repairs and restores damaged or weathered stone surfaces to improve appearance and stability.
Crack and Joint Repair - fills and seals cracks to prevent further deterioration and maintain structural integrity.
Ledge and Step Repair - restores cracked or broken ledges, steps, and flat surfaces for safety and aesthetics.
Mortar Repointing - replaces deteriorated mortar joints to strengthen stone structures and prevent water intrusion.
Stone Replacement - replaces severely damaged stones to preserve the integrity of the overall structure.
Cleaning and Sealing - cleans stone surfaces and applies sealants to protect against stains and weather damage.
Stonework Repair Questions
What types of stonework repairs are commonly needed? Repairs often include fixing cracked or chipped stones, resetting loose stones, and restoring damaged mortar joints to maintain structural integrity and appearance.
How can I tell if my stonework needs repair? Signs include visible cracks, shifting stones, loose sections, or deteriorated mortar that affects the stability or aesthetics of the stone features.
What materials are used for stonework repair? Repairs typically involve matching existing stone and mortar materials to ensure a seamless and durable restoration.
Are stonework repairs suitable for historic or decorative features? Yes, repairs can be tailored to preserve the original look and integrity of historic or decorative stone features.
